Abstract

The utility model provides a kind of novel plastic lifter, including plastic guide rail, rolling wheel and steel wire rope, and plastic guide rail both ends are respectively arranged with mounting hole, pulley spindle fixed part and pulley, and the pulley spindle fixed position is in the top of the mounting hole;The pulley is provided with pulley spindle, and the pulley spindle bottom passes through the mounting hole, and top passes through the pulley spindle fixed part, and the pulley peripheral edge is wound with the steel wire rope, and the both ends of the steel wire rope are all wrapped on the rolling wheel.Due to pulley is arranged on plastic guide rail by pulley spindle, the upper and lower end of pulley spindle is each passed through pulley axial trough and mounting hole, passed around afterwards by steel wire rope on the mounting groove of pulley, steel cord ends are simultaneously wrapped on rolling wheel by tense wire rope, make pulley install with pulley guide rails by the tension of steel wire rope to fix, it is simple in construction, and damping noise reduction better performances, suitable for big specification industrialized production.

A kind of novel plastic lifter
Technical field
Plastics lifter field is the utility model is related to, more particularly to a kind of novel plastic lifter.
Background technology
The pulley fixed form of current automobile steel guide rail glass-frame riser is that pulley riveting is fixed, the riveting work of steel aluminium The technique for fixing of skill and novel plastic is not quite identical, if directly applied on novel plastic lifter, can cause seriously to lose Effect, thus need existing environment and under the conditions of, seek a kind of new pulley fixed form, possess novel plastic lifter Good structural mechanical property, mechanical efficiency, damping noise reduction performance, fatigue performance, creep resisting ability and of a relatively high Produce economic benefit in batches.
Utility model content
Based on this, it is necessary to provide a kind of structure simplification, the novel plastic lifter of damping noise reduction better performances.
Technical scheme:A kind of novel plastic lifter, including plastic guide rail, rolling wheel and steel wire rope, both ends are respectively arranged with Mounting hole, pulley spindle fixed part and pulley, the pulley spindle fixed position is in the top of the mounting hole;
The pulley is provided with pulley spindle, and the pulley spindle bottom passes through the mounting hole, and top passes through the pulley spindle Fixed part, the pulley peripheral edge have passed around the steel wire rope, and the both ends of the steel wire rope are all wrapped on the rolling wheel.
Above-mentioned technical proposal, due to pulley is arranged on plastic guide rail by pulley spindle, the upper and lower end difference of pulley spindle Through pulley spindle fixed part and mounting hole, after passed around by steel wire rope on pulley, tense wire rope simultaneously twines steel cord ends Be wound on rolling wheel, by the tension of steel wire rope pulley and pulley guide rails be installed and fixed, it is simple in construction, and damping noise reduction performance compared with It is good, suitable for big specification industrialized production.
In one of the embodiments, the pulley periphery is circumferentially with the mounting groove of ring-type, and the steel wire rope passes around In the mounting groove of the pulley.
Above-mentioned technical proposal, due to that provided with mounting groove, the movement locus of steel wire rope can be limited, ensure that steel wire rope will not take off Fall.
In one of the embodiments, pulley groove is additionally provided with the plastic guide rail, pulley groove is located at the mounting hole Top and the lower section for being located at the pulley spindle fixed part, the pulley are placed in the pulley groove.
In one of the embodiments, pulley spindle fixed part is provided with pulley axial trough, and the top of the pulley spindle passes through institute State pulley axial trough.
In one of the embodiments, the plastic guide rail is led for plastics made of the polypropylene material of glass fiber reinforcement Rail.
Beneficial effect:Novel plastic lifter of the present utility model, there is advantages below:
1) due to pulley is arranged on plastic guide rail by pulley spindle, the upper and lower end of pulley spindle is each passed through pulley spindle Fixed part and mounting hole, after passed around by steel wire rope on pulley, steel cord ends are simultaneously wrapped on rolling wheel by tense wire rope, Make pulley install with pulley guide rails by the tension of steel wire rope to fix, it is simple in construction, and damping noise reduction better performances, suitable for big rule Lattice industrialized production.
2) remove staking process, on the one hand effectively avoid part breaking or riveting stuck, avoid riveting and made an uproar caused by gap Sound;On the other hand, when meeting with external impacts or alternate load, the frictional resistance of pulley rotation can be reduced, improves transmission efficiency.
3) simple in construction, material is easy to get, and reduces parts usage, reduces production cost.
4) this design middle pulley convenient disassembly, can help quality or the more effective analysis product problem of Application Engineer.

Embodiment
Below in conjunction with the accompanying drawing in the utility model embodiment, the technical scheme in the embodiment of the utility model is carried out Clearly and completely describing, it is clear that described embodiment is only the utility model part of the embodiment, rather than whole Embodiment.Based on the embodiment in the utility model, those of ordinary skill in the art are not under the premise of creative work is made The every other embodiment obtained, belong to the scope of the utility model protection.
Fig. 1~3, a kind of novel plastic lifter, including plastic guide rail 100, rolling wheel 200 and steel wire rope 300 are referred to, is moulded Material guide rail 100 both ends are respectively arranged with mounting hole 1, pulley spindle fixed part 2, pulley 3 and pulley groove 5, and pulley groove 5 is located at mounting hole 1 top, pulley spindle fixed part 2 is located at the top of pulley groove 5, and pulley spindle fixed part 2 is provided with pulley axial trough 21;Pulley 3 Pulley spindle 4 is provided with, the bottom of pulley spindle 4 passes through mounting hole 1, and top passes through pulley axial trough 21, and pulley 3 is installed in pulley groove 5, The periphery of pulley 3 is circumferentially with the mounting groove 31 of ring-type, and steel wire rope 300 passes around in the mounting groove 31 of two pulleys 3 respectively, steel wire The both ends of rope are all wrapped on rolling wheel 200.Wherein, plastic guide rail 100 is modeling made of the polypropylene material of glass fiber reinforcement Expect guide rail.
During design:
1, pulley 3 is provided with the mounting groove 31 being used for around steel wire rope 300, may be such that steel wire rope 300 will not using mounting groove 31 Come off, without separately setting block;
2, it is necessary to keep concentricity between the pulley groove 5- mounting holes 1 on pulley spindle 4- pulley axial trough 21- plastic guide rails;
3, its dimensional tolerance is paid close attention to, gap is determined, verifies whether to meet design requirement.
Assembly technology:
1, pulley 3 is arranged on plastic guide rail 100 by pulley spindle 4 first, and pulley 3 is located in pulley groove 5;
2, the mounting groove 31 of pulley 3 is passed through with steel wire rope 300, and the both ends of steel wire rope 300 are all wrapped in rolling wheel 200 On.
Mounting hole 1, pulley groove 5 are located on plastic guide rail 100, and the pulley spindle that pulley axial trough 21 is located at plastic guide rail 100 is consolidated Determine in portion 2, be molded by the integral molded plastic of plastic guide rail 100;Pulley spindle 4 is the part of fixed block 3, and pulley 3 is fixed on into plastics In pulley groove 5 on guide rail 100;Pulley 3 is fixed on plastic guide rail 100 by the tension of steel wire rope 300 simultaneously.
